Celestun Biosphere Reserve: A Birdwatcher’s Haven

Private Tour Celestun Flamingo Watching and Beach - Celestun Biosphere Reserve: A Birdwatchers Haven

The Ria Celestun Biosphere Reserve is the tour’s first stop, where the private boat takes you into a magical mangrove landscape. This ecosystem is home to over 560 species of animals, making it a prime spot for birdwatching. Expect to see tiger herons, gulls, Canadian ducks, and crocodiles, with a chance of spotting spider monkeys if luck is on your side.

The highlight for many visitors is the flamingos, especially December to March, when they perform their courtship displays and low flights. The boat ride offers a close-up view of these elegant birds as they gather in large flocks. The reserve’s natural beauty and diverse wildlife make this a particularly memorable part of the tour.

Flamingo Sightings: Nature’s Spectacle

Private Tour Celestun Flamingo Watching and Beach - Flamingo Sightings: Natures Spectacle

Celestun is renowned as a main breeding ground for American flamingos. The migration season from December to March is when flamingos are most visible, performing their courtship dances and feeding behaviors. During this period, visitors can expect to see thousands of pink birds in their natural habitat.

It’s important to note that flamingo sightings are not guaranteed year-round, as they depend on weather conditions and migration timings. Still, the possibility of witnessing this spectacle makes the trip highly worthwhile. Many reviews mention seeing large flocks, feeding, and flying in formation, which creates incredible photo moments.
